JDHalfrack's Fantasy Draft Utility

JDHalfrack
All-Pro
Posts: 161
Joined: Mon Jul 25, 2011 7:16 am

JDHalfrack's Fantasy Draft Utility

Postby JDHalfrack » Wed Nov 13, 2013 1:39 pm

Okay, it's been a while... but JDHalfrack proudly presents his latest editor: the Fantasy Draft Utility!

Requirements: You will need .NET Framework 3.5 installed to use this utility

ALWAYS MAKE A BACKUP OF YOUR FRANCHISE FILE BEFORE USING THIS UTILITY!!
(you should always make a backup of whatever file is going to be edited before using any utility)

To use this utility:
Step 1a: In Madden '08, load up whatever roster you want to use, and stat a franchise with it.
Step 1b: DO NOT START A FANTASY DRAFT FRANCHISE! Use any other settings you want and control whichever human teams you want... BUT DO NOT START A FANTASY FRANCHISE.
Step 1c: Save the franchise immediately after creation (and before doing minicamp drills <-- not that necessary) and exit Madden.

Step 2: Make a backup of your franchise and then load up the original in the Fantasy Draft Utility. When it's loaded, you should see this screen:
Image

At this stage, you get to set all your options for how the computer will treat the drafting process.
On this main screen, you can set the draft type, draft order, number of rounds, and select which teams you would like to draft for as a human.
You will also notice there are two buttons: "Edit Overall Ratings Formula" and "Edit Player Evaluation Formula".

The first button should not be messed with unless you know that the franchise you are using is using any other formula than the default formula provided by Madden. Since most (read: nearly 100%) of the users will have no idea that a formula even exists, or that we actually know what it is and how it works, I would just leave this button alone. But, if you absolutely must know, this is what the screen looks like that pops up when you click it:
Image

The second screen, though, is where all the magic happens:
Image
I will not spend time explaining all the workings of that screen here since I have tried to explain as much as I could in the actual utility.

Step 3: After you have saved all the settings, and are ready to proceed, click the "Save Draft Order and BEGIN DRAFT" button. That will bring you to a screen that looks similar this (depending on version and when I've updated this forum):
Image

This screen is fairly self explanatory, but I will point out a few things.
- "Auto Update Draft Info" is nifty, but it drags the speed of the utility WAY down (because it constantly is clearing and rebuilding all that stuff). So, if you notice the drafting speed is taking too long, uncheck that box. If you have selected a team to draft for, you may not notice it too much. However, if you have selected no teams, the draft will complete in like 30 seconds. But, with auto update on, it takes about 5 mins.
- "Computer Draft Player" will have the computer draft a player based on the drafting AI and randomness (as set in the Edit Player Evaluation" screen).
- "Draft Players without Prompt" will get rid of the warning every time you click to draft a player.

Step 4: After the draft is complete, save the franchise!

Have fun, and try to break this utility. I want to know about anything that goes wrong no matter how little or no matter how big. There are some annoying thing I already know about that I will fix/add later. I wanted to get this released though. Good luck, and have fun!

JD

UPDATES
Version 2.3 (11/21/13):
- fixed issue with draft freezing after a certain round
(depending on "1st" requirements)
- fixed issue with draft boards not displaying properly

Version 2.2 (11/19/13):
- Fixed the Halfback/Fullback jersey number issue
- Changed the progress bar label to display the file name when opened
- Added "Offense" and "Defense" to the "sort by" combo box
- Changed default number of draft rounds to 53
- The drafted players list now auto-scrolls long with the current pick
(can be disabled)

Version 2.1 (11/16/13):
- Should open and handle franchises with a practice squad (BETA)
- Players are listed as having been "Acquired in Fantasy Draft"
- Okay.... NOW I've fixed the contract issue...
- Fixed the kick/punt returner depth chart issues
- Fixed the scrolling issue where the player list wouldn't scroll to the top after switiching search criteria

Version 2.0 (11/15/13):
- This utility will now auto-order depth charts during the draft

Version 1.2 (11/15/13):
- fixed issue with players getting drafted with no salary
(hopefully correctly this time)
- fixed issue with some players getting assigned illegal jersey numbers
- adjusted the numerical order players receive new jersey numbers to be more realistic with league standards
- fixed issue with dealing with ratings larger than 99
(now all attributes will be read as if they have a cap of 99... but they are still treated as their actual value)
- fixed issue with updating team draft info when picking back to back picks
- added a back color to rows on the player list when viewing "all players" if they've already been drafted
- added an option to "check/uncheck" all teams when selecting user teams

Version 1.1 (11/14/13):
- enabled and updated "About..." box
- added auto draft option
- made it so the last sorted column in the player grid will remain the sorted column when switching positions
- fixed the player list loading then reloading when switching between "ALL", "Drafted" and "Undrafted" views
- added a spot for the "best 5" attributes to be displayed when a player is selected
- added the height, weight, and years pro info to the same location
- fixed the issue of players being signed to zero years in a fantasy draft (all free agents are now signed to a 1 year deal)
- made it so that drafted players will no longer share jersey numbers (the first drafted player gets priority)

Version 1.0 (11/13/13):
- initial release
Attachments
Fantasy Draft Utility (version 2.3).zip
MAKE SURE BOTH FILES ARE PACKAGED TO THE SAME LOCATION!
(155.22 KiB) Downloaded 1628 times

JDHalfrack's Fantasy Draft Utility

Sponsor

Sponsor
 

User avatar
RevanFan
Legend
Posts: 12680
Joined: Fri Jul 15, 2011 5:25 pm
Location: New York

Re: JDHalfrack's Fantasy Draft Utility

Postby RevanFan » Wed Nov 13, 2013 3:18 pm

It doesn't work for me. I tried it with an already in progress franchise and a new franchise that followed your instructions. It always gives me an error saying "The index was outside the bounds of the array" and then it crashes. I have tried it in administrator mode as well, and it did the same thing.
Support me on Cash App - $RevanFan
Historic Cowboys Teams Mod
My Cowboys Journal
I'm a die hard Cowboys fan and a lifelong New Yorker.

mike9472
MVP
Posts: 689
Joined: Sun Jul 24, 2011 8:46 pm

Re: JDHalfrack's Fantasy Draft Utility

Postby mike9472 » Wed Nov 13, 2013 3:29 pm

Tried it with a new franchise and it worked fine for me. I'm running Windows XP 32 bit with NET framework 1 thru 4.

JDHalfrack
All-Pro
Posts: 161
Joined: Mon Jul 25, 2011 7:16 am

Re: JDHalfrack's Fantasy Draft Utility

Postby JDHalfrack » Wed Nov 13, 2013 3:35 pm

RevanFan wrote:It doesn't work for me. I tried it with an already in progress franchise and a new franchise that followed your instructions. It always gives me an error saying "The index was outside the bounds of the array" and then it crashes. I have tried it in administrator mode as well, and it did the same thing.


Index outside the bounds errors are very easy to fix. Would you attach or PM me your franchise so I can see what is triggering the error? Let me know what steps you did and I'll try to replicate the error.

JD

User avatar
Austinmario13
Hall of Fame
Posts: 3703
Joined: Mon Oct 10, 2011 4:57 pm
Location: Odessa, TX
Contact:

Re: JDHalfrack's Fantasy Draft Utility

Postby Austinmario13 » Wed Nov 13, 2013 3:58 pm

Can you do the NFL Draft on this?

JDHalfrack
All-Pro
Posts: 161
Joined: Mon Jul 25, 2011 7:16 am

Re: JDHalfrack's Fantasy Draft Utility

Postby JDHalfrack » Wed Nov 13, 2013 4:01 pm

Austinmario wrote:Can you do the NFL Draft on this?


No. But there are already WAY better tools than this that cover the NFL draft.

JD

User avatar
slydways
Banned
Posts: 917
Joined: Wed Jan 09, 2013 7:41 pm
Location: Alliance,Ohio ........Home of the MOUNT UNION PURPLE RAIDERS 11 Division III National Championships

Re: JDHalfrack's Fantasy Draft Utility

Postby slydways » Wed Nov 13, 2013 4:23 pm

Another Great One ! Thanks JD. FDU worked fine on both my... XP and... win7 x64 machines and only needs NET 2.0 SP1 ( for XP ) and nothing for Windows 7 x64.

User avatar
superben21
MVP
Posts: 622
Joined: Fri Aug 05, 2011 1:44 pm
Location: Ohio

Re: JDHalfrack's Fantasy Draft Utility

Postby superben21 » Wed Nov 13, 2013 4:25 pm

Sweet! About to check this out when I get home tonight.

Now if only I could get that league shrinker working I'd have a way to break this utility :P
~ Superben21 | An active moderator at one point or another.

petroleum
All-Pro
Posts: 141
Joined: Wed Aug 17, 2011 1:32 pm

Re: JDHalfrack's Fantasy Draft Utility

Postby petroleum » Wed Nov 13, 2013 5:37 pm

RevanFan wrote:It doesn't work for me. I tried it with an already in progress franchise and a new franchise that followed your instructions. It always gives me an error saying "The index was outside the bounds of the array" and then it crashes. I have tried it in administrator mode as well, and it did the same thing.

Were you using a roster/franchise with a practice squad team? I tried using the fantasy draft utility on a franchise started with StruttDaddy-2003 roster, except that I had added the practice squad team to it, and ran into "The index was outside the bounds of the array" error. However, using a franchise started with the original StruttDaddy-2003 roster (without practice squad team) did not generate that error.

JDHalfrack
All-Pro
Posts: 161
Joined: Mon Jul 25, 2011 7:16 am

Re: JDHalfrack's Fantasy Draft Utility

Postby JDHalfrack » Wed Nov 13, 2013 6:04 pm

Oh yeah, it should be noted that currently, this utility is designed for default franchises. It won't (probably) work with any shrunken league, any league with custom teams added (unless the TGID is less than 32), etc...

In the future, the plan is to make it compatible with any league size with any league teams. Like I said, I am just trying to release what I've been able to put together so far. Version 2 will include those kinds of updates.

JD


Return to “Utilities”

Who is online

Users browsing this forum: No registered users and 6 guests